Description

Presenting a superb opportunity to acquire a welcoming three-bedroom semi-detached house, perfectly positioned in a popular residential area. This lovely family home offers spacious accommodation throughout, thoughtfully designed for comfortable living and entertaining. Upon entering, you are greeted by a entrance hall that leads into a generous living room, ideal for relaxing with family or hosting guests. The kitchen is well-appointed with ample storage and workspace, a delightful conservatory that floods the space with natural light and provides an inviting spot for unwinding. Upstairs, three well-proportioned bedrooms offer flexible sleeping arrangements, complemented by a contemporary family bathroom. With its versatile layout and charming features, this property is sure to appeal to families and professionals alike seeking a home that combines practicality with warmth and style. Step outside to discover a beautiful enclosed rear garden, thoughtfully landscaped to provide the perfect balance of low maintenance and outdoor enjoyment. The garden features a spacious area, ideal for al fresco dining or summer barbeques, while the artificial lawn ensures a lush green outlook all year round with minimal upkeep. A long driveway provides ample off-road parking and leads to a single garage, offering additional storage or parking options. This outdoor space is perfect for children to play safely or for adults to relax and entertain in a private setting. Entrance

Via double glazed door to hallway

Entrance Hallway

Stairs to first floor landing, radiator.

Lounge

3.97m x 3.23m

Feature fire place, radiator, double glazed bay window to the front.

Dining Room

3.28m x 2.9m

Radiator, double glazed patio doors to rear.

Conservatory

4.1m x 2.9m

Double glazed windows to two side, French doors to rear, ceiling fan, double glazed door to side.

Kitchen

3.46m x 2.18m

Fitted with a range of wall and base units to round edged work tops, 1 1/2 sink unit with mixer taps, gas cooker, plumbed for washing machine, double glazed window and door.

Landing

Double glazed window, loft access.

Bedroom One

3.99m x 3.06m

Fitted wardrobes, radiator, double glazed window.

Bedroom Two

2.78m x 2.87m

Fitted wardrobes, ceiling fan, radiator, double glazed window.

Bedroom Three

3.04m x 1.97m

Radiator, double glazed window.

Bathroom/WC

Low level wc, pedistal wash hand basin, panelled bath, shower cubical, tiled walls, radiator, double glazed window.

Garden

Beautiful enclosed rear garden with patio and artifical lawn
